Key Responsibilities
As RCM & Reliability Engineering Manager, you will:
- Lead the remote analysis of RCM data from locomotive assets to identify faults, trends and early intervention opportunities, reducing in-service failures.
- Ensure high-priority RCM alerts are actioned promptly, reviewing remedial actions and driving improvements in repair quality.
- Develop and implement condition-based maintenance strategies across the RCM-fitted fleet.
- Monitor and manage operational alerts, including braking systems, speed restrictions and locomotive stabling issues.
- Provide technical support to depot teams undertaking maintenance and repairs.
- Manage In-Service Defects (ISDs), liaising with drivers, control, ground staff and depots to achieve optimal return-to-service outcomes.
- Coach and mentor maintenance staff, improving technical knowledge, capability and confidence.
- Develop engineering solutions to enhance safety, reliability and cost efficiency.
- Undertake technical investigations and produce formal reports into incidents, failures and defects across traction and rolling stock.
- Conduct test runs, technical riding and load banking of locomotives where required.
- Support production teams across all UK depots with technical queries and fault resolution.
- Provide structured feedback to specialist system suppliers to support self-learning algorithm optimisation.
- Work closely with operations, engineering and production stakeholders to ensure real-time alerts are acted upon.
- Support nationwide track-side assistance decisions, including for third-party customers.
- Use RCM data and repair history to develop fault-finding guides that reduce downtime and improve first-time fixes.
- Collaborate with fleet maintenance control to optimise asset availability.
- Influence reliability initiatives by trending, interpreting and presenting RCM data.
- Identify operational trends and support the operations function with actionable insights.
